Red Sox Nation lost another member of the curse-breaking 2004 team when Dave McCarty
passed away earlier this month. He's the second guy from that team to pass away in the past year, along with Tim Wakefield. He had just made an appearance during the Red Sox home opener too, celebrating the 20th Anniversary of that championship. Being only 6 years younger than McCarty, it's a little jarring.
